Onboarding: Tax-Rate Lookup Cache (Velmora Billing)

The tax-rate lookup cache sits between the Velmora checkout service and the Quillard rates provider. It refreshes every six hours and falls back to the last known table if the provider is unreachable. For local development, run the seed script to populate sample jurisdictions, then copy the env template into your working directory. The cache warmer authenticates against the staging rates endpoint, so append the credential line below.

sealed setting: RELAY_SECRET5=82864

Subject: Calibration weights — pick-up today

Dispatch: batch of twelve certified calibration weights, crated at Dock 2, Norvale plant. Destination: Ashmere metrology room. Crate is heavy — use the trolley, two-person lift. Certificates are sealed inside the lid pocket; do not open. Handle upright only, no stacking. Collection window closes 15:30. Shift lead to sign the transfer log before the crate leaves the dock. Confirm departure by radio. The hand-over instruction for the courier is set out on the line below.

courier memo of yahif-faweg: the quenael tamius courier leaves the prawyn jorix kaswyn istox silmir brieth zormir fenvan ledger at gate 3145 under passcode 231062

# Break-Glass: Catalog Cache Invalidation

Scope: the Pinrow product catalog at Veldstone Retail. If stale prices persist after a purge and the Hollowmere invalidation queue is wedged, use break-glass to flush the edge tier directly. Contractors: get verbal sign-off from the catalog lead first. Steps: open the Hollowmere admin shell, select emergency-flush, confirm the tenant, and run it once — repeated flushes thrash the origin. Access is logged and expires after 20 minutes. Unseal the admin shell with the passphrase below.

recovery phrase for kahop-tajog: istix-casvan